Company Overview
Lannon Tank Company, LLC is a dynamic manufacturer specializing in aboveground (AST) and underground (UST) storage tanks. Job Summary
We are seeking an energetic and detail-oriented Customer Logistics and Documentation Coordinator to join our team. In this vital role, you will manage logistics documentation, coordinate shipments, and provide exceptional customer service to ensure smooth operations. Your multilingual skills and strong communication abilities will help us serve a diverse client base effectively while maintaining accurate data entry and documentation processes.
- Coordinate customer ship dates, delivery schedules, and site contact information to ensure accurate and timely deliveries.
- Serve as the primary point of communication between customers, internal teams, and the 3PL provider for outbound shipments.
- Prepare all shipping documentation, including bills of lading, packing lists, labels, and any required compliance paperwork.
- Manage and produce the serialization and traceability documentation for tank products, ensuring accuracy and regulatory compliance.
- Verify that all shipment details align with customer requirements, internal production schedules, and inventory availability.
- Maintain organized records of shipping documents, serial numbers, and delivery confirmations.
- Collaborate and assist sales, engineering, operations, inventory, purchasing, and quality with assigned tasks to help ensure smooth workflow and information flow.
- Write Up, Enter and Maintain accurate records of all purchase orders, entry into our ERP system E2 ECI JobBoss.
- Support continuous improvement of logistics and documentation processes to enhance accuracy and efficiency.
- Experience in logistics coordination, shipping, customer service, or manufacturing operations preferred. Minimum 3 years in the office.
- Strong organizational skills with a high level of attention to detail.
- Ability to communicate clearly and professionally with customers, carriers, and internal teams.
- Proficiency with standard office software (Excel, Word, ERP systems preferred).
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- Familiarity with shipping documentation or serialization processes is a plus.
